Getting to the Second Gift: Welcoming and Retaining New Donors

tulip blue mailbox

The moment a donor makes a first gift is cause for celebration.

Whether it was your amazing donor acquisition campaign, your organization’s inspirational work in the community, or your powerful website, you’ve compelled someone to take action and make a gift!

But now the more important work begins: inspiring your new donor to give again.

From your pool of fresh new supporters, you’ll begin to weed out those one-gift-only donors and identify those with potential to become long-term and even lifelong partners in your mission.

A second gift is an important indication of a deeper interest in your organization’s work. It signals that a donor’s giving is more than an afterthought or obligation. These are the donors that are worthy of your focus and limited resources.

But second gifts don’t happen automatically – they must be thoughtfully cultivated.

Why you should abandon LYBUNTS and SYBUNTS.

Stocksy_txp507a3c543gv000_Small_621855

Unless you are brand-new to the world fundraising, I’d be willing to bet you’ve heard the terms LYBUNT (last year but unfortunately not this) and SYBUNT (some years but unfortunately not this) in reference to donors who’ve failed to renew their support.

Despite the fact this jargon is deeply engrained in the nonprofit fundraising lexicon (your donor database probably has a canned report that will automatically pull a list of lybunts, for example), it’s misleading, problematic, and should be banished from your terminology asap.

Dig into Your Donor Data to Grow Your Annual Fundraising

Dig inThere’s more to measuring your annual fundraising than how much money you raised. To get the full story, you’ve got to measure performance in terms of your donors as well.

Your donor data reveals critical information that you’ll need in order to improve your fundraising and make the most of the giving potential within your database.

It tells you which donors are responding to your outreach and illuminates how well your strategies and tactics are working.

How Does Your Donor Retention Stack Up?

Stack up

Have you taken a close look at your donor retention from last year?

Specifically, you want to discover what percentage of your donors from 2013 gave a gift in 2014. Measuring your retention rates each year is hugely important because it’s a critical indicator of weather your fundraising is improving… or not.

The elusive lapsed donor: devise a plan to get them back

upside down walkerWe’ve all got them.  Supporters who, for one reason or another, have slipped away.

Our lapsed donors, because they’ve already demonstrated they care about our mission, are clearly worthy of some significant effort and attention.

Yet many nonprofits do nothing more than mail the same letters and newsletters that everyone else gets, cross their fingers, and hope for the best.

If you attempt only one new thing for your annual fundraising this year, developing thoughtful, intentional ways to get your lapsed donors back will provide a great return on investment.
